数据库删除表
@巢胡5947:SQL..如何用命令删除数据库中所有的表? -
晏陶19157985162…… 要删除所有的用户表: declare @sql varchar(8000) SELECT @sql='drop table ' + name FROM sysobjects WHERE (type = 'U') ORDER BY 'drop table ' + name exec(@sql) 如果要删除所有用户表中的内容,可以执行以下语句: declare @sql ...
@巢胡5947:sql语句删除数据库表的几种方式及区别 -
晏陶19157985162…… 加where条件 删除表的话:drop table if exists `table`,`table2`,`table3`; 删除表数据的话: 1、delete from t1 where 条件 2、delete t1 from t1 where 条件 3、delete t1 from t1,t2 where 条件 也就是简单用delete语句无法进行多表删除数据操作,不过可以建立级联删除, 在两个表之间建立级联删除关系,则可以实现删除一个表的数据时,同时删除 另一个表中相关的数据.
@巢胡5947:sql server 删除表语句怎么写 -
晏陶19157985162…… drop database 数据库名 --删除数据库的 drop table 表名--删除表的 delete from 表名 where 条件 --删除数据的 truncate table 表名 也是删除数据库的.但是他可以裁断序列 这个你跟DELETE 对照试一下就知道了
@巢胡5947:数据库表的删除方式有drop、delete和truncate哪个最快? -
晏陶19157985162…… 意义是不一样的,drop是删除表,使用drop之后表结构和表的数据都会被删除,truncate 和 delete是删除表里的数据,但不删除表本身,truncate 和 delete相比,truncate要快很多,但缺点就是不能回滚,包括索引等都会变成初始值,数据就无法恢复了.
@巢胡5947:Mysql 删除表 -
晏陶19157985162…… DROP TABLE table_name (删除表);delete from 表名 where 删除条件(删除表内数据,用 delete);truncate table 表名(清除表内数据,保存表结构,用 truncate). 扩展资料: 1、MySQL中删除数据表是非常容易操作的, 但是你再进行...
@巢胡5947:oracle 数据库中怎么删除表内容? -
晏陶19157985162…… 删除表内容的两种方法1. truncate table 表名;2. delete from 表名 where 条件;3. 两种方法的区别:1. truncate,意思为截断表,能够不占用资源的全部删除表,优点是速度快,缺点是删除不能恢复,不能按条件删除.2. delete,意思为删除,此操作占用redolog,优点能够快速恢复和选择删除,缺点是删除慢,大批量的删除不建议使用.
@巢胡5947:oracle中如何删除所有表 -
晏陶19157985162…… 1、如果想要删除相应的表格,那么首先要知道表格位于那个数据库,这样才可以进行删除. 2、然后需要打开数据库,你会看到数据库内有很多表格. 3、往下拉,我们自己新建的表格一般都是位于最末端,找到表格右击.4、右击选择“表”你会看到侧边栏会弹出“删除”点击他. 5、这时会提示你是否删除表格,如果想要彻底删除表格,那么必须要将约束条件和清除√这样才会删除的更彻底.
@巢胡5947:怎么删除数据库中的某一表
晏陶19157985162…… drop table from(表名)
晏陶19157985162…… 要删除所有的用户表: declare @sql varchar(8000) SELECT @sql='drop table ' + name FROM sysobjects WHERE (type = 'U') ORDER BY 'drop table ' + name exec(@sql) 如果要删除所有用户表中的内容,可以执行以下语句: declare @sql ...
@巢胡5947:sql语句删除数据库表的几种方式及区别 -
晏陶19157985162…… 加where条件 删除表的话:drop table if exists `table`,`table2`,`table3`; 删除表数据的话: 1、delete from t1 where 条件 2、delete t1 from t1 where 条件 3、delete t1 from t1,t2 where 条件 也就是简单用delete语句无法进行多表删除数据操作,不过可以建立级联删除, 在两个表之间建立级联删除关系,则可以实现删除一个表的数据时,同时删除 另一个表中相关的数据.
@巢胡5947:sql server 删除表语句怎么写 -
晏陶19157985162…… drop database 数据库名 --删除数据库的 drop table 表名--删除表的 delete from 表名 where 条件 --删除数据的 truncate table 表名 也是删除数据库的.但是他可以裁断序列 这个你跟DELETE 对照试一下就知道了
@巢胡5947:数据库表的删除方式有drop、delete和truncate哪个最快? -
晏陶19157985162…… 意义是不一样的,drop是删除表,使用drop之后表结构和表的数据都会被删除,truncate 和 delete是删除表里的数据,但不删除表本身,truncate 和 delete相比,truncate要快很多,但缺点就是不能回滚,包括索引等都会变成初始值,数据就无法恢复了.
@巢胡5947:Mysql 删除表 -
晏陶19157985162…… DROP TABLE table_name (删除表);delete from 表名 where 删除条件(删除表内数据,用 delete);truncate table 表名(清除表内数据,保存表结构,用 truncate). 扩展资料: 1、MySQL中删除数据表是非常容易操作的, 但是你再进行...
@巢胡5947:oracle 数据库中怎么删除表内容? -
晏陶19157985162…… 删除表内容的两种方法1. truncate table 表名;2. delete from 表名 where 条件;3. 两种方法的区别:1. truncate,意思为截断表,能够不占用资源的全部删除表,优点是速度快,缺点是删除不能恢复,不能按条件删除.2. delete,意思为删除,此操作占用redolog,优点能够快速恢复和选择删除,缺点是删除慢,大批量的删除不建议使用.
@巢胡5947:oracle中如何删除所有表 -
晏陶19157985162…… 1、如果想要删除相应的表格,那么首先要知道表格位于那个数据库,这样才可以进行删除. 2、然后需要打开数据库,你会看到数据库内有很多表格. 3、往下拉,我们自己新建的表格一般都是位于最末端,找到表格右击.4、右击选择“表”你会看到侧边栏会弹出“删除”点击他. 5、这时会提示你是否删除表格,如果想要彻底删除表格,那么必须要将约束条件和清除√这样才会删除的更彻底.
@巢胡5947:怎么删除数据库中的某一表
晏陶19157985162…… drop table from(表名)